The newest teaser trailer is teasing the return of one of the most iconic Star Trek villains of all time. Q returns in season 2 of Picard! I would link the teaser below but it seems to have been removed. Instead, you can check out the interviews conducted with the cast.
There is a bit of bad news though. Picard season one ended over a year ago now, so it’s been a while. Unfortunately, it seems like the second season is still a long way out as well. The pandemic seems to have taken a toll on the entertainment industry as a whole, which is rather unfortunate. Picard season 2 will be coming out in 2022 and will apparently be debuting on Paramount+. It’s rather exciting! I’m not even a Star Trek fan but even I might check it out because of Q’s return.
